Job Description Job Description Supports and coordinates the daily and recurring administrative functions of the Office of Student Affairs while implementing effective practices to ensure student success and efficient departmental operations. Provides direction, support, and guidance to all student organizations about operations, communications, budgets, and events. This position involves accessing sensitive and confidential information on almost a daily basis thus requiring the highest level of discretion. Demonstrates a high level of computer literacy to produce written materials and maintain data. Assists with all internal and external Law School room reservations. Highly involved in event planning and publication.
Primary roles and responsibilities:
Provides comprehensive assistance and support to the Assistant Dean of Student Affairs and the Office of Student Affairs. Manages and coordinates logistics of all exam accommodations and exam conflicts for midterms, finals, and quizzes. Manages 25+ student organizations each year. Serves as liaison between Law School's Office of Student Affairs and the University's Accessibility Services Director and Center for Health and Wellness. Assists with Law School room reservations for internal and external constituencies.
Qualifications :
Knowledge and skills at a level normally acquired through the completion of a high school diploma. College degree preferred and/or 1+ years of Student Affairs experience or other specialized training. Possesses excellent skills in Microsoft Office Suite applications (Word, Excel, Publisher, PowerPoint, Outlook), video conferencing platforms such as Zoom, and can readily learn new computer software applications and platforms. Experience preferred in using an administrative information system such as Ellucian Colleague. Flexibility to prioritize and manage multiple tasks and deadlines. Detail-oriented. Requires minimal supervision and demonstrates initiative. Excellent professional communication skills (verbal and written). Supports departmental goals and priorities.
